Atom編輯器入門到精通(五) Git支持

版本控制對於開發來講很是重要,Atom固然也提供了很好的支持,本文將介紹如何在Atom中集成使用Git和GitHub git

恢復文件

當你修改了某個文件,而後發現改得不滿意,但願恢復文件到最後一次提交的狀態,可使用Cmd+Alt+ZCheckout Head Revision命令
此命令將會放棄你對文件全部的修改,直接將文件恢復爲最後一次提交的版本
至關於Git命令git checkout HEAD -- filenamegit reset HEAD -- filename
Checkout
若是恢復文件後發現仍是改過之後的好,可使用Cmd+Z來撤銷剛纔的修改 github

顯示狀態

在前文中講過,咱們能夠經過Cmd+T/Cmd+P列出全部項目中的文件,或Cmd+B列出全部當前打開的文件,
或是Cmd+Shift+B來列出全部新建的或更改過的文件
全部的這些方法都會在彈出的文件列表的右邊以圖標的形式顯示文件的狀態
特別是Cmd+Shift+B,它會列出全部未跟蹤或是更改過的文件,至關於Toggle Git Status Finder命令
git status 編輯器

編輯提交信息

你能夠經過以下命令將Atom設置爲Git的默認編輯器atom

 
 
 
 
  • 1
  • 1
git config --global core.editor "atom --wait"

這樣當你提交時就會使用Atom來編輯提交信息
而且Atom還支持提交信息的高亮
git-message .net

狀態欄圖標

Atom會在窗口右下角顯示當前Git的狀態,好比當前的分支名,當前文件的狀態等
git-status-bar 3d

顯示當前文件更改狀況

Atom會用三種顏色來表示當前文件的更改狀況
git-lines
你還能夠經過快捷鍵Alt+G ↑Alt+G ↓來將光標從當前文件的一塊更改移到另外一塊更改 版本控制

GitHub支持

若是你的代碼託管在GitHub上,掌握下列命令可讓你更方便地工做
* Alt+G O 在GitHub上打開當前文件
* Alt+G B 在GitHub上用Blame方式打開當前文件
* Alt+G H 在GitHub上用History方式打開當前文件
* Alt+G C 將當前文件在GitHub上的URL複製到剪切板
* Alt+G R 在GitHub上比較分支
open-on-github code

相關文章
相關標籤/搜索